# How to auto resolve alerts

You can set up auto resolves for your alerts under **Audit** > **Alert settings** > **Prebuilt.**

<figure><img src="/files/Cdjg216ovG1POliyBGo5" alt=""><figcaption></figcaption></figure>

**Popular examples**

* Automatically add highly converting search terms as keywords
* Automatically add poorly converting search terms as negative keywords
* Exclude underperforming display placements

#### **Where to find the auto resolve log**

<figure><img src="/files/qrOIyo1ptD4TyhhntKx1" alt=""><figcaption></figcaption></figure>

You can find the log in **Audit** > **Auto resolve log**. Each entry in the log will show the exact details of the changes made. You can also **undo** the change if you prefer.&#x20;
